CHAP. 171.— An act granting lands to the State of Minnesota in lieu of certain lands heretofore granted to said State. March 3, 1879. *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the United States of America in Congress assembled*, Minnesota. That there be, and hereby are, granted to the State of Minnesota, to be selected by the governor of Grant of lands in lieu of former grant.said State, twenty-four sections of laud, out of any public lands of the United States not otherwise appropriated, in lieu and in stead of twenty-four sections of the land granted to said State of Minnesota by the fourth subdivision of section five of an act entitled “An act to authorize the people of the Territory of Minnesota to form a constitution and 1857, ch. 60,[11 Stat., 166](/us/stat/20/166).State government preparatory to their admission in the Union on an equal footing with the original States”, approved February twenty-sixth, eighteen hundred and fifty-seven, and selected by said State, but which were subsequently otherwise disposed of by the United States, and to which the United States cannot make title to the said State of Minnesota:*Proviso*. *Provided,* That the lands herein granted shall be selected within three years, and from unoccupied lands of the United States lying within the State of Minnesota.
Approved, March 3, 1879.
